Fresno, CA. – 31-year-old Shaylee Henry has been identified as the woman who died after being struck by a car on Friday night in Fresno.
The fatal collision happened around 9 p.m. on Santa Ana Avenue near Fashion Fair Mall, according to the Fresno Police Department.
Police reportedly attempted to pull over a car near Gettysburg Avenue and First Street but the driver failed to yield and sped off into a residential area where it struck a man and a woman.
The vehicle sped off before it crashed into a pole near Thesta and Santa Ana.
Henry died at the accident scene.
The male pedestrian was taken to the hospital in critical condition.
The driver of the car fled the scene and was yet to be located.
More details about the accident were not released.
An investigation into the accident is ongoing.
